Publication number: 20110225890Abstract: A gate for selectively restricting passage through a passageway includes a frame having a sill and first and second door jambs adapted for mounting within the passageway. A door is mounted by hinges to the first door jamb while a latch receptacle is mounted to the second door jamb. A pedal is movably mounted to the door as is a latch element. The latch element is slidable between an extended position, where the latch element engages the latch receptacle so that the door of the gate is locked in a closed position, and a retracted position, where the latch element is removed from the latch receptacle so that the door may be moved into an open position. A sliding linkage is connected between the pedal and the latch element so that the latch element is moved into the retracted position when the pedal is actuated. A magnet is positioned in the latch element and in the latch receptacle so as to pull the latch element into the extended position when the latch element is not engaged by the sliding linkage.Type: ApplicationFiled: March 17, 2010Publication date: September 22, 2011Inventors: Mark Greenwood, Piet Schilt

Patent number: 7946633Abstract: A roller pin of the type mounted on a tie bar that slides to drive the roller pin into engagement with a keeper of a casement window includes an inner pin and an outer roller. The outer roller includes an integral outer flange that is circular and spins with the outer roller to reduce friction during engagement with keeper. The inner pin includes an offset mounting pin at one end and is enlarged at the other end to hold the outer roller on the inner pin. The enlarged end of the inner pin is flush with the outer flange and is provided with a recessed opening that receives a tool, such as a screwdriver, to rotate the inner pin and adjust its position relative to the tie bar and a keeper. The invention is also directed to a tie bar and multiple roller pins in combination.Type: GrantFiled: September 10, 2007Date of Patent: May 24, 2011Assignee: Interlock USA, Inc.Inventor: Peter Minter

Patent number: 7814705Abstract: An automatic storm shutter. A shutter is hingeadly attached to a wall over a structure opening. An actuator is attached to the shutter, and releasably engaged with a support, which is rigidly attached to the wall. When external atmospheric pressure descends, as would happen at the approach of a wind storm such as a tornado, gas pressure within the actuator automatically releases the actuator from the support, which permits the shutter to quickly close as urged by gravity, to cover the structure opening and protect it from storm winds. An alternate embodiment is disclosed wherein one or more additional shutters are installed below the automatic storm shutter. The shutters are mutually attached with an elongate member. When the automatic storm shutter automatically closes, so also do the shutters below.Type: GrantFiled: December 23, 2008Date of Patent: October 19, 2010Inventor: Robert S. Reed

Publication number: 20100218427Abstract: Described is an electronic pet door for automatically granting a selected animal access to a through-way defined by the electronic pet door and denying a non-selected animal access to the through-way. The selected animal carries a transmitter. The electronic pet door includes a corresponding receiver and a frame that defines the through-way, which has a tapered contour. A flap, which has a tapered contour corresponding to the through-way, is disposed within the through-way and is capable of a locked position and an unlocked position. When in the locked position, the flap denies access to the through-way. When unlocked, the flap grants an animal access to the through-way. The flap is locked and unlocked by way of a locking mechanism that shifts the flap longitudinally between the less tapered and most tapered portions of the through-way. The locking mechanism shifts the flap in response to the receiver.Type: ApplicationFiled: May 19, 2010Publication date: September 2, 2010Applicant: Radio Systems CorporationInventors: James R.
